How much does it cost to rent a home in Orlando?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Orlando 2 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$1,742 | $940 | $3,550 |
| Orlando 3 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$2,216 | $1,499 | $10,000+ |
| Orlando 4 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$2,714 | $1,600 | $4,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Orlando
What type of rentals are currently available in Orlando?
There are currently 1483 Apartments for Rent in Orlando, FL with pricing that ranges from $250 to $25,645. There are also 2638 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Orlando ranging from $850 to $12,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Orlando?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Orlando ranges from $850 to $12,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,877.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Orlando?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Orlando range from $748 to $9,309,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,499 to $12,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,600 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$625.
